        To keep nuts, bolts, screws, and nails organized, use clear plastic bins with compartments, or small parts organizers with labeled drawers. Magnetic strips on the wall can securely hold metal items, while fishing tackle boxes or craft organizers with multiple compartments work well for sorting. Stackable, labeled bins or jars save space and keep items accessible. Pegboards with attached jars or containers keep things visible and off your workbench, and divider trays inside drawers help separate different fasteners. These solutions will make your projects smoother and keep everything easy to find! πŸ› οΈπŸ”©
